Driving difficulty heat maps for autonomous vehicles

1. A method of generating a driving difficulty heat map for autonomous vehicles, the method comprising:
inputting, by one or more processors, log data generated by a vehicle being driven in a manual driving mode for a segment of a route into a disengage model in order to generate an output identifying a likelihood of a vehicle driving in an autonomous driving mode requiring a disengage from the autonomous driving mode along the segment of the route, the log data being collected within a geographic area;
generating, by the one or more processors, a grid for the geographic area, the grid including a plurality of cells;
assigning, by the one or more processors, the output to one of the plurality of cells;
using, by the one or more processors, the plurality of cells and assigned output to generate a driving difficulty heat map for the geographic area; and
identifying, by the one or more processors, a geographic area to be excluded from a service area for the autonomous vehicles in real time based on the driving difficulty heat map.
